Different expression of sodium-iodide importer (NIS) between lactating breast and thyroid tissues may be due to structural difference of thyroid-stimulating hormone receptor (TSHR).
Shi, X-Z; Xue, L; Jin, X; Xu, P; Jia, S; Shen, H-M.
